Outpatient treatment

Treatment for depression treatment medications in outpatient settings provides an environment that is safe to work with mental health professionals to address the underlying causes of the illness. The process typically begins with an assessment to determine your needs and goals. After the assessment, a customized care plan will be created for you. This may include medication and psychotherapy. This plan will help to understand your symptoms, create healthy coping mechanisms, and learn to manage your emotions. The therapy sessions will offer a safe space to discuss your experiences with others.

Outpatient therapy may take place at a treatment center or a private clinic. During these sessions, you'll talk to a licensed therapist to discuss your feelings and behavior. The sessions can be conducted in a group or one-on-one arrangement, depending on the center and your preferences. The therapists will frequently check in with you to assess your progress and make any necessary adjustments. You will also have the opportunity to engage in self-awareness and psychoeducation exercises that are crucial to your recovery.

If your depression is moderate to severe, an intensive outpatient program might be the right option for you. These programs are a step down from more intensive levels of treatment like inpatient or partial hospitalization, and provide flexible scheduling to fit into your busy schedule. These programs are typically less expensive than inpatient services and are therefore affordable for those with limited resources. The intensive outpatient program usually includes therapy sessions that could last for five hours and are scheduled multiple times a week.

Psychological assessment

Psychiatric tests are similar to medical exams but focus on mental health issues. These tests can help determine if a person has an illness of the mind and the best way to treat depression way to treat it. They can be performed by a psychiatrist or other mental health professionals. They can be conducted in a public setting, such as private offices or outpatient clinics.

A psychiatric assessment usually involves a physical examination, interview, and tests in the laboratory. The doctor will inquire about your symptoms. When they first started and for how long and what caused them to get worse or better. They will also ask about any other medical conditions that you suffer from, for instance an imbalance in your thyroid. These tests can help eliminate some physical conditions which may cause depression such as a viral infection or metabolic imbalances.

Adults teens, children, and adults suffering from mental illness are able to receive treatment for mental illness. They can include group psychotherapy, private therapy and family therapy. They can help you how to manage your emotions and improve your relationships. Certain psychological treatments such as cognitive behavior therapy (CBT), can teach you to alter destructive patterns of thinking and behaviors. Other treatments, such as interpersonal therapy (IPT) are focused on how life events can affect your mood and behavior.

All patients receiving primary care in VA medical centers are encouraged to undergo a screening for depression and mental illness. However, the screening process is not often conducted due to the lack of resources and education in clinical practice. However, a number of studies have shown that integrated care models and disease management programs can improve the frequency of treatment for depression in primary care settings. One model, Depression Improvement Across Minnesota offering a New Direction(DIAMOND) is a collaborative program that integrates primary health care providers and psychiatrists to manage depression within the primary care setting.

Light therapy

Light therapy is a type of psychotherapy in which the patient to bright light for between 30 and 60 minutes each day. It can be used alone or in conjunction with other treatments for depression. The light is believed to stimulate melatonin and increase serotonin levels. It can also improve sleep patterns and boost your energy. The results of studies aren't always consistent. Some are positive, whereas others have no impact. It is crucial to choose the appropriate treatment for your condition.

Research suggests that light therapy could be an effective treatment for SAD that is triggered by lack of sunlight and has the pattern of a season. The symptoms often begin in the fall and last into spring. It is the first line of treatment for SAD, and it can be effective when it is used along with therapy for talk as well as lifestyle and behavioral changes, and medication.

The light therapy device emits an intense light that resembles natural sunlight. The typical treatment involves sitting in front of the light for between 30 and 60 minutes each day. The light intensity varies by device however the most popular is 10,000 lux (lux refers to the brightness of light). The lights can be positioned on the top of a desk or on stands that allow you to move around or work while using the light. It is recommended to use the lights during daylight hours, beginning in the morning or around midday.

It is not yet evident if light therapy can be effective in treating depression that is not seasonal. Many of the studies are insignificant, short and have methodological problems. The results suggest that light therapy is moderately effective, however, it is not as reliable as a placebo. However, more well-designed studies are needed to support the efficacy of this treatment.
